It can also result in delusions, hallucinations, arrhythmia, cardiac arrest, coma, and even death. In addition to hypertension or hypotension, caffeine overdose may produce tachycardia, vomiting, and fever. It’s possible that caffeine concentrations of more than 15 mg/kg of body weight are harmful to the cardiovascular, neurological and gastrointestinal systems, to name a few examples (e.g., ca 1 g of caffeine for a person weighing 70 kg).Īlthough high caffeine levels are difficult to get from acute coffee drinking, people may easily achieve high caffeine levels with the use of caffeine tablets. On the other hand, symptoms of coffee poisoning might manifest themselves at levels far lower than deadly dosages. When caffeine use is progressively decreased, withdrawal symptoms often peak between 20 and 48 hours following the last caffeine intake however, they may generally be avoided if caffeine intake is gradually lowered (Nehlig, 2010).Įxcessive coffee intake has no significant organic toxicity, although it may cause unpleasant side effects, such as caffeine withdrawal symptoms, if consumed in large quantities. Other symptoms include depression, anxiety, and irritability. The most common coffee withdrawal symptoms include headaches, feelings of exhaustion, weakness, and drowsiness, poor concentration, fatigue, and job difficulty, depression, anxiety, irritability, increased muscle tension, and, on rare occasions, tremors, nausea, and vomiting.
